Job description

AFL is a leader in the infrastructure landscape, delivering engineering, construction, and field services for critical infrastructure providers across Canada and the U.S. Our highly skilled and experienced professionals design, build, connect, and maintain the critical systems and networks that power modern communities and industries — keeping people, businesses, and services seamlessly connected.

From our roots in telecommunications, where we are recognized as trusted experts with a proven track record of delivering large-scale, end-to-end, high-impact projects for Canada's largest telecommunications providers, to servicing and maintaining water and power meter systems, AFL Network Services ensures critical infrastructure and systems are expertly deployed and maintained.

We are growing and currently looking for a full time Data Validation Clerk

Under the guidance of the Manager of Administration and Data Validation Clerk is responsible for entering and validating timecards and orders to ensure accurate timecard submissions for all assigned Technicians, thus ensuring accurate pay for technicians. The Data Validation Clerk will be responsible for document control, data corrections, and validation of completed job orders as reported in both AFL and client systems. In addition, the incumbent may be required to support Field Technicians with expense management.

Responsibilities
  • Ensure timesheets for assigned Technicians and Manager approvals are submitted on time and if required, follow-up to ensure submission prior to deadline
  • Identify missing entries and elevate to Manager level to ensure completion
  • Verify Technician job order entries in AFL and client systems to ensure alignment
  • Validate Technicians’ completed tasks and complete accurate data entry into relevant systems or spreadsheets
  • Correct Technician(s) time entry issues prior to uploading into corporate financial system
  • Advise Technician(s) and other relevant stakeholders of discrepancies and errors to ensure accurate records
  • Maintain and update master list of Technicians and Associated Managers to ensure up-to-date reporting lines
  • Complete various reports as required
  • Address Technician pay issues and re-open orders if required to process necessary corrections
  • Manage daily emails and calls from Technicians and other departments and provide answers and support accordingly
  • Participate in team meetings to review projects, processes and status updates
  • Provide back‑up support for team members, as required
  • Provide support to field employees on time entry, expense procedures and customer timesheets
  • Provide onboarding support and training for new hires related to business unit procedures
  • Complete ad hoc administrative projects as requested
  • Enhance Organization reputation by accepting ownership for accomplishing requests and exploring opportunities to add value to job accomplishments
  • Adhere to and promote the environmental, health & safety policies of AFL
  • Perform other duties as requested, directed or assigned
